Sainsbury's

The Sainsbury's online grocery shopping service is an excellent way to stock up on everyday food items. You can choose the date and time that you want to receive your groceries. There are options for all budgets regardless of whether you're looking for a single item or a regular shopping trip.

Sainsbury's founded in 1869, is the second-largest chain of supermarkets in the UK. It has a market share of 16. percent. The company offers a wide range of goods such as food, clothing and household items. It also provides banking services via Sainsbury's Bank, and operates the Argos chain of retail stores. Its headquarters are located in Holborn, London.

In recent years the retailer has diversified its online offerings. In 2015, the company launched an app that was designed to improve the customer experience and increase the capacity of delivery. Sainsbury's offers same-day deliveries in certain locations. Currently Sainsbury's delivers its products to more than 40 million homes and business in the UK.

Sainsbury's increased its investment in its own-brand products to be competitive with German discounters like Aldi and Lidl. Sainsbury's has reduced prices on its most well-known products and also offered price matching on certain products. This has allowed Sainsbury's to grow sales faster than Tesco and Asda.

According to a price-tracking website, Alertr, ASDA has recently become the cheapest online grocery retailer in the UK. The site looked at the price of 42 items, which included milk, bread, eggs pasta, rice, and cereals, in a typical shopping trolley. It discovered that ASDA was nearly PS7 cheaper than Tesco for the basket, which comprised both own-brand and branded products. Morrisons, Waitrose, and Ocado were also in the top five supermarkets. The results were based on the cost of a weekly shop and excludes Aldi and Lidl.

The Co-op, a UK-based cooperative retailer, has teamed up with Uber Eats in order to provide a delivery service to its members. The partnership is expected to boost the number of members at the Co-op from five million to eight million by 2030. In addition to the partnership with Uber, Co-op has revamped its membership offer and introduced a new round of Member Price. This includes 117 days of low prices for its members in its food business, which includes brand-name products for the very first time.
